Answer ( 1 )

  1. A business strategy in which growth is obtained by increasing the number of stores in which customers can buy a company’s products and services whereas business expansion entails opening up new stores in different physical locations while still maintaining the current business locations.

Leave an answer


Captcha Click on image to update the captcha .

About Neha SharmaSilver